Royal Caribbean Cruises v. Payumo

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Third District
Dec 15, 1992
608 So. 2d 862 (Fla. Dist. Ct. App. 1992)

Opinion

No. 91-3056.

October 20, 1992. Rehearing Denied December 15, 1992.

Appeal from the Circuit Court of Dade County, Philip Bloom, J.

Canning Murray Peltz and Robert D. Peltz, Miami, for appellant.

Rivkind Pedraza and Brett Rivkind, Miami, for appellee.

Before BARKDULL, HUBBART and FERGUSON, JJ.


This is an appeal from a nonfinal order denying defendant Royal Caribbean Cruises, Ltd.'s motion to dismiss the plaintiff Ariston Payumo's action for Jones Act negligence [46 U.S.C.App. § 688 (1985)] and unseaworthiness under United States Maritime Law. The action arose out of certain personal injuries sustained by the plaintiff, a Filipino seaman, when he slipped and fell aboard the defendant's vessel while in the Bahamas. Contrary to the defendant's arguments, we agree with the trial court that the action was not barred by improper venue, forum non conveniens, or lack of subject matter jurisdiction, based on the controlling authority of Rojas v. Kloster Cruise, A/S, 550 So.2d 59 (Fla. 3d DCA 1989), rev. denied, 562 So.2d 346 (Fla. 1990), because the defendant's principal place of business and base of operations was, as in Rojas, Dade County, Florida. We have not overlooked and have carefully considered the defendant's contrary contentions upon this appeal, but are not persuaded thereby.

Affirmed.
